    You can do bike only days, but they're not cheap. It would be with instruction.
    I had a great time just doing open to the public laps. Just treat it like in between the best ever ride out on a road with traffic and a track day. Keep an eye on your mirrors for traffic faster than you, but they only overtake one side if you return to the other.
